    If you went to the Intel site and downloaded the drivers with the version ending in 4764 -- those are the same drivers. I have a Fujitsu table running those drivers but I got mine from one of the Fujitsu websites, sorry, don't remember which one. They are actually XPDM drivers, meaning they are XP-era, and they will NOT do Aero. period.

    First of all, those are "GV" drivers, not "GM" drivers. So, if you really have an Intel 915GM chipset, those drivers might not work.

    Second, Intel never wrote any Vista or Win7 drivers for the 915-series chipset. You have to install the XP drivers, and you'll probably have to use XP compatibility mode to do that.
